· Distribution of Iron Ore in India – Iron ore in Orissa, Jharkhand, Chhattisgarh, Karnataka & other states. Types of Iron Ore. Haematite, Magnetite, Limonite & Siderite. Haematite. Reddish; best quality; 70 per cent metallic content. Found in Dharwad and Cuddapah rock systems of the peninsular India.

5. Goa-It is India's top iron ore exporting state. Iron ore mined here is exported to countries such as China and Japan. Important deposits are found in these regions - Pirna, Sirigao, Sanquelime, Kudnem in North Goa. Goa produces iron ore with Fe content of 55-58 per cent ( it's a low-grade ore). Iron ore is the main ingredient for making steel.

Where Can Iron Be Found? Iron can be found in the Earth's core, in the Earth's crust, in hemoglobin, in steel and in magnets. It is rare to find iron in its elemental form on Earth, but it has been found in igneous rocks in Russia. Iron is a shiny gray metal. When it oxidizes, the resulting compound is known as iron oxide or rust.
